Selamat datang lagi di blogku, salam pintar bahasa komputer. Kali ini saya akan posting tentang struktur dasar algoritma dan program flowchart.
1. Struktur Penulisan Algoritma
Struktur dasar penulisan algoritma terdiri dari tiga bagian yaitu :
1. Judul
Digunakan untuk menulis komentar mengenai algoritma seperti : cara kerja program kondisi awal dan kondisi akhir algoritma.
2. Kamus
Digunakan untuk mendefinisikan nama konstanta, nama type, nama variable, nama prosedur dan nama fungsi yang digunakan dalam algoritma.
3. Algoritma
Digunakan untuk menuliskan algoritma dalam menyelesaikan masalah secara terstruktur.
Hubungan antara algoritma, masalah dan solusi dapat digambarkan sebagai berikut :
- Tahap pemecahan masalah adalah Proses dari masalah hingga terbentuk suatu algoritma.
- Tahap implementasi adalah proses penerapan algoritma hingga menghasilkan solusi.
- Solusi yang dimaksud adalah suatu program yang merupakan implementasi dari algoritma yang disusun.
Ciri algoritma yang baik adalah :
- Algoritma memiliki logika perhitungan atau metode yang tepat dalam menyelesaikan masalah.
- Menghasilkan output yang tepat dan benar dalam waktu yang singkat.
- Algortima ditulis dengan bahasa yang standar secara sistematis dan rapi sehingga tidak menimbulkan arti ganda (ambiguous).
- Algortima ditulis dengan format yang mudah dipahami dan mudah diimplementasikan ke dalam bahasa pemrograman.
- Semua operasi yang dibutuhkan terdefinisi dengan jelas.
- Semua proses dalam algoritma harus berakhir setelah sejumlah langkah dilakukan.
Pemrograman adalah proses membuat software komputer dengan menerapkan algoritma dan struktur data tertentu menggunakan bahasa pemrograman. Algoritma adalah metode dan tahapan sistematis yang digunakan untuk memecahkan suatu permasalahan.
Struktur data adalah tempat tatanan penyimpanan data yang dibutuhkan program pada komputer,
Kode program yang telah ditulis di-compile dan dieksekusi untuk menjalankannya. Compile adalah menerjemahkan kode program yang ditulis menggunakan bahasa pemrograman, ke bahasa mesin yang dapat dimengerti oleh komputer sehingga komputer mengerti apa yang diperintahkan.
2. Apa itu FLOWCHART??
Flowchart adalah suatu bagan dengan simbol-simbol tertentu yang menggambarkan urutan proses secara mendetail dan hubungan antara suatu proses (instruksi) dengan proses lainnya dalam suatu program.
Ini dia simbol-simbol dalam flowchart yg akan kita pelajari.
Flowchart terbagi atas lima jenis, yaitu :
- Flowchart Sistem (System Flowchart)
- Flowchart Flowchart Dokumen (Document Flowchart)
- Flowchart Skematik (Schematic Flowchart)
- Flowchart Program (Program Flowchart)
- Flowchart Proses (Process Flowchart)
Contoh Flowchart :




0 komentar:
Posting Komentar